Match score not available

Full Stack Developer (Mid-Level) -Remote

Remote: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

5-7 years of IT experience focusing on AI/ML projects., 3+ years deploying production applications in AWS., Strong skills in Java, Python, and Rust., Bachelor's degree in a STEM field preferred..

Key responsabilities:

  • Deliver scalable and secure systems.
  • Collaborate with project and product managers.
Iron EagleX, Inc. logo
Iron EagleX, Inc.
201 - 500 Employees
See more Iron EagleX, Inc. offers

Job description

Overview:

Iron EagleX is a veteran owned defense contracting company based in Tampa, FL.

 

It is our mission to provide solutions to the most challenging technical problems facing the Department of Defense while simultaneously making a positive impact on our employees and community.

Responsibilities:

 

Iron EagleX is looking for a REMOTE Mid-Level Full Stack Developer to join our team, delivering scalable and secure systems. You will use user-centered and agile methodologies to build and continuously deploy server and client-side solutions. As a member of the team, you will collaborate with project and product managers, user experience designers, and business analysts. Your efforts will directly serve and assist end-users. Your work will be produced in the context of the team's practices, including but not limited to continuous development, deployment, integration, and monitoring. Our solutions need to be "cloud-first", scalable, and deployed in containers. Full stack engineers on this project are expected to have experience developing or integrating databases as well as developing and integrating server and client applications.

 

Job Duties Include (but not limited to):

  • Write and deploy server-side applications in containerized environments on AWS
  • Write clean, concise, and maintainable code
  • Actively participate in merge requests
  • Help define and enforce development best practices
  • Automate pain points in the software development process (local development and CI/CD pipeline)
  • Contribute to the development of user stories, acceptance criteria, and participate in story estimation
  • Participate in writing automated tests to verify the intent of stories
  • Support other developers through code reviews and pairing when they have questions or hit blockers
  • Support and improve the overall system and server-side data-center applications to run on AWS
  • Investigate data quality issues raised by users of the system
  • Investigate errors in applications and perform root cause analysis
  • Research data sources for ways to expand the usefulness of the system
  • Provide application programming interfaces (APIs) and services
  • Contribute to hardening OS images, applications, and containers
  • Perform security scans and produce reports of the outcomes
Qualifications:

Required Skills & Experience:

  • Minimum of 5-7 years of experience in the Information Technology field focusing on AI/ML development projects using DevSecOps and AWS cloud environments
  • Experience with full stack engineering, including at least 3 years of experience deploying production enterprise applications in AWS that use AI/ML
  • 3 years of specific software engineering experience related to front-end and back-end applications and/or data services
  • Experience in large scale, high-performance enterprise big data application deployment and solution architecture on complex heterogeneous environments in AWS
  • Experience with automation and engineering tasks, AI/ML implementation, data, infrastructure/operations, and security engineer tasks in USCIS cloud environments
  • Experience with containerized environments and orchestration (Docker, Kubernetes)
  • Strong programming skills in Java, Python, Rust, and C++
  • Experience with frameworks such as Spring Boot, Actix, and TensorFlow
  • Proficiency with front-end frameworks like Angular, React, or Vue
  • Database experience with PostgreSQL, MySQL, MS SQL, and MongoDB
  • Familiarity with infrastructure tools like Jenkins and Terraform
  • Languages: Java 8+, Rust, Go (Golang), Kotlin backend, and JavaScript or TypeScript frontend
  • Frameworks: Spring Framework (preferably Spring Boot), Node.js, Redux
  • Infrastructure: Jenkins, Terraform, Amazon Web Services (AWS)
  • Development Tools: Git, Gradle, Maven
  • Development Methodologies: Test Driven Development, Agile Software Delivery, Scrum, Continuous Integration/Continuous Deployment
  • Due to U.S. Government contract requirements, only U.S. citizens are eligible for this role. 

Desired Skills:

  • Experience with applying DoD security technical implementation guides (STIGs) and automating that process
  • Experience with working in defense or intelligence community cloud environments is a plus
  • Experience with developing and managing machine images or templates to automate cloud deployments
  • Experience with optimizing cloud environments, including leveraging native cloud capabilities, right-sizing servers, expanding storage, and tracking cost efficiencies at the microservice level
  • Experience with configuring and aggregating logs for data analysis using Splunk or ELK solutions

Education & Certifications:

  • Bachelor’s degree in a STEM field with preference towards Computer Science and Software Engineering preferred.

 

Security Clearance: 

  • An active TS/SCI security clearance is Required

Benefits:

  • National health, vision, and dental plans
  • 20 days of PTO and 11 paid holidays
  • Life Insurance
  • Short and long term disability plans
  • 401(K) retirement plan
  • Incentive and recognition programs
  • Relocation opportunities

 

Iron EagleX is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, religion, color, national origin, sex, sexual orientation, gender identity, age, status as a protected veteran, among other things, or status as a qualified individual with disability. 

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Collaboration
  • Communication
  • Problem Solving

Full Stack Engineer Related jobs